As one other review noted the roller part is hard to get the paint out of. Typically when you load up the paint a decent layer of pint should come right out when you do your first roll which you then spread out over 2 or 3 roller lengths of the wall. It’s a struggle to get that first layer out which requires additional pressure and results on roller marks by the time you are done. What should’ve been 2 layers ended up requiring 3 or 4 - on a budget this works well enough but I think most people will end up using extra paint then is necessary
